/* CSS Document */
body{ padding:0px; margin:0px; font-family:arial; background:url(../images/body-bg.jpg)  top  repeat-x;}
h1,h2,h3,h4,h5,p,a,ul,li{ padding:0px; margin:0px; list-style:none; text-decoration:none; font-weight:normal;}
img{ border:0px; float:left;}
.fleft{ float:left;}
.fright{ float:right;}
img{ border:0px; float:left !important;}

#header-main{ width:100%; margin:0px auto; background:url(../images/header-bg.jpg) top center no-repeat; height:549px;}
#header{ width:996px; margin:0px auto;}
#header-top{ width:950px; float:left; height:130px; padding-left:46px;}
#header-top h1{ font-family:"Palatino Linotype"; font-size:30px; color:#FFFFFF; padding:15px 0 0 0;}
#header-top p.network{ width:400px; text-align:left; font-family:arial; font-size:14px; color:#FFFFFF; float:left;}
#header-top p.advice{ width:530px; padding-right:20px; text-align:right; font-family:arial; font-size:18px; font-weight:normal; color:#FFFFFF; float:left;}
#header-steps{ width:250px; float:left; margin:0 68px 0 413px;}
#header-steps h2{font-family:verdana; font-size:20px; color:#053663; font-weight:bold; height:38px;}
#header-steps h2.step2{margin-top:63px;}
#header-steps h2.step3{margin-top:64px;}
#header-steps h3{font-family:verdana; font-size:14px; color:#4A5E00; font-weight:bold; height:22px;}
#header-steps h3.step21{font-family:verdana; font-size:14px; color:#4A5E00; font-weight:bold; height:38px;}
#header-steps p{ font-family:verdana; font-size:12px; color:#053663; padding-top:10px;}
#header-quote{ width:250px; float:left;}
#header-quote h2{ font-family:arial; font-size:18px; font-weight:bold; color:#053663; height:40px;}
#header-quote ul{float:left; width:100%;}
#header-quote ul li{ font-size:13px; color:#053663; font-family:verdana; width:100%; float:left;}
.text-field{ border:1px solid #214E76; width:215px; font-family:arial; font-size:12px; color:#000000; margin:2px 0 7px 0;}
.text-field1{ border:1px solid #214E76; width:210px; font-family:arial; font-size:12px; color:#000000; margin:2px 0 7px 0; }
.text-field2{ border:1px solid #214E76; width:210px; font-family:arial; font-size:12px; color:#000000; }

#content-main{ width:100%; background:url(../images/main-bg.jpg) center repeat-y; overflow:hidden;}
#content{ width:990px; margin:0px auto;}
#menu {width:990px; background:url(../images/menu-bg.jpg) repeat-x; height:36px;font-family:Verdana;font-size:16px; color:#FFFFFF; padding:15px 0 0 0; font-weight:bold; float:left;}
#menu a{ color:#FFFFFF; margin:0 35px 0 35px; width:auto;}
#menu a:hover{ color:#B2B2B2;}
#clear{ width:990px; float:left;}
#content-left{ margin:0 28px 0 25px; width:515px; float:left;}
#content-left h4{ background:url(../images/content-left-bg.jpg); height:124px; float:left; width:100%; margin-bottom:20px;}
#content-left h4 span.con{ font-family:"Palatino Linotype"; font-size:24px; color:#053663; font-weight:bold; padding-top:50px; float:left; width:380px;}
#content-left h4 span.image{ width:132px; float:left;}
#content-left p{ font-family:verdana; font-size:13px; color:#2D2D2D; width:100%; float:left;}


#content-right-doctor{ width:365px;float:left; background:url(../images/content-right-bg.jpg); height:895px; padding:0 0 0 40px;}
#content-right-doctor h4{ height:74px; float:left; width:100%; margin-bottom:20px; font-family:"Palatino Linotype"; font-size:24px; color:#053663; font-weight:bold; padding-top:50px;}

#content-right-doctor ul{ width:365px; float:left;}
#content-right-doctor ul li{ float:left; position:relative;}
#content-right-doctor ul li.pic{ width:120px; padding:0 0 0 10px;}
.picborder{ border:1px solid #6A6A6A; width:93px; height:115px;}
#content-right-doctor ul li.piccontent{ width:235px;}
#content-right-doctor ul li span{ width:235px; float:left; font-family:verdana; font-size:15px; color:#2D2D2D; font-weight:bold; background:none; height:auto;margin-top:3px; margin-left:0px;}
#content-right-doctor ul li p{width:235px; float:left; font-family:verdana; font-size:13px; color:#2D2D2D; margin-top:5px;}
#content-right-doctor ul li a{width:235px; float:left; font-family:verdana; font-size:13px; color:#003CFF; font-weight:13px;margin-top:5px; font-weight:bold;}
#content-right-doctor ul li a:hover{ text-decoration:underline;}
#content-right-doctor span{ width:358px; float:left; height:34px; background:url(../images/divider.jpg) no-repeat;}
#content-bottom-link
{
	width:904px;
	float:left;
	background:url(../images/link-bg.jpg);
	/*background:#0f0f0f;*/
	margin:20px 0 0 27px;
	height:197px;
	padding:0 0 0 32px;
}
#content-bottom-link h5{
	width:904px;
	float:left;
	height:60px;
	font-family:"Palatino Linotype";
	font-size:24px;
	font-weight:bold;
	color:#053663;
	padding-top:7px;
}
#content-bottom-link ul
{
	margin:0px;
	padding:0px;
	list-style:none;
	float:left;
	position:relative;
	padding-top:8px;
}
#content-bottom-link ul li
{
	padding:0px;
	margin:0px;
	list-style:none;
	font-family:verdana;
	font-size:13px;
	color:#353535;
	line-height:17px;
}
#content-bottom-link ul li a
{
	font-family:verdana;
	font-size:13px;
	color:#353535;
	text-decoration:none;
	padding:0px;
}
#content-bottom-link ul li a:hover
{
	text-decoration:underline;
}
#content-bottom-link ul.first
{
	width:300px;
	
}
#content-bottom-link ul.mid
{
	width:300px;
	
}
#content-bottom-link ul.last
{
	width:300px;
	
}
#content-bottom{ width:100%; background:url(../images/bottom-image.jpg) center no-repeat; overflow:hidden; height:25px; margin-bottom:10px;}
#footer
{
	width:100%;
	float:left;
	height:22px;
	font-family:verdana;
	font-size:13px;
	color:#2D2D2D;
	text-align:center;
	margin:0px auto;
	height:35px;
	overflow:hidden;
	
}
#footer a
{
	font-family:verdana;
	font-size:13px;
	color:#2D2D2D;
	text-decoration:none;
}
#footer a:hover
{
	text-decoration:underline;
}






/*add css 230709 */
.black_overlay{
	display: none;
	position: absolute;
	top: 0%;
	left: 0%;
	width: 100%;
	height: 1200px;
	background-color: black;
	z-index:1001;
	-moz-opacity: 0.8;
	opacity:.80;
	filter: alpha(opacity=80);
}
.white_content {
	display: none;
	position: absolute;
	top: 250px;
	left: 25%;
	width: 50%;
	height: 400px;
	padding: 16px;
	border: 3px solid #88BA1D;
	background-color: white;
	z-index:1002;
	overflow: auto;
}
#RequestDiv-top{ float:right;}
#RequestDiv-bottom{width:100%;}
#RequestDiv-bottom h2{ color:#BB5100; font-size:27px; font-weight:bold; text-align:center; width:100%;  padding:10px 0 20px 0; margin:0px;}
#RequestDiv-bottom ul{width:100%; float:left;font-weight:bold; font-size:17px; color:#BB5100; padding:0px; margin:0px; list-style:none;}
#RequestDiv-bottom ul li{ float:left;}
#RequestDiv-bottom ul li.reqleft{width:40%; padding:0 10px 0 0; text-align:right; float:left; height:38px;}
#RequestDiv-bottom ul li.reqright{width:55%;float:right;height:38px;}
.reqfield{border:1px solid #AFAFAF; width:200px;color:#939393; font-size:14px; }


/*06-08-09*/

#inner-content { width:990px; float:left; margin:0 auto; padding:0; list-style:none; background:url(../images/inner-bg.jpg) no-repeat top;  }
#inner-content h2 {font-family:"Palatino Linotype"; font-size:24px; color:#053663; font-weight:bold; padding:20px 0px 45px 50px;}
.inner-content-text {font-family:Verdana, Arial, Helvetica, sans-serif; font-size:14px; color:#2D2D2D; float:left; padding:0px 45px 0px 50px;}

/*
===========================
DOCTOR LISTING Section
===========================
*/

#content-list-doctor { width:990px; float:left; margin:0 auto; padding:0; list-style:none; background:url(../images/inner-bg.jpg) no-repeat top; }
#content-list-doctor h2 {font-family:"Palatino Linotype"; font-size:24px; color:#053663; font-weight:bold; padding:20px 0px 45px 50px;}
#content-list-doctor ul{ width:300px; float:left; margin:0px 0px 0px 35px; padding-top:0; margin-top:0; }
#content-list-doctor ul li{ float:left; padding:0; margin:0; }
#content-list-doctor ul li.pic{ width:80px; padding:0px 0px 0px 0px; float:left; }
#content-list-doctor ul li.piccontent{ width:180px; float:left;}
#content-list-doctor ul li.piccontent span{width:180px;float:left; font-family:arial; font-size:13px; color:#3C3C3A; font-weight:bold; margin-left:0px;}
#content-list-doctor ul li p{width:130px; float:left; font-family:arial; font-size:13px; color:#3C3C3A;}
#content-list-doctor ul li a{color:#0000ff; text-decoration:none;font-family:arial; font-size:12px; width:130px; float:left;}
#content-list-doctor ul li a:hover{ text-decoration:underline;}




